If you want more students, engagement, and brand awareness, short-form video is the way to go. Here’s why:

 

1. People Have Short Attention Spans

  • TikTok, Reels, and Shorts keep content under 60 seconds.

Quick, engaging videos get higher retention and more shares.

 

2. Viral Potential (Even With a Small Account)

  • Unlike traditional social media, these platforms don’t require followers to get views.
  • A well-made video can reach thousands—even millions—overnight.

 

3. It Builds Trust & Community

  • Short videos let potential students see your school’s vibe and values.

People buy from people they trust—video builds that connection fast.

5 Winning Content Ideas for Martial Arts Schools

 

Not sure what to post? Start with these high-performing content ideas:

 

1. Technique Breakdowns (Fast & Simple)

  • Example: “The easiest way to escape a rear naked choke (in 10 seconds!)”
  • Why it works: Educational content builds authority and trust.

 

2. Student Success Stories

  • Example: A beginner student sharing how martial arts changed their confidence.

 

Why it works: Emotional stories create powerful connections. Need a jumping-off point? Check out our blog for 20+ Video Ideas

 

3. Behind-the-Scenes Footage

  • Example: Fun clips of warm-ups, sparring, or instructor bloopers.
  • Why it works: People love feeling like insiders.

 

4. Challenge-Based Content

  • Example: “Try this 30-second balance challenge—bet you can’t do it!”
  • Why it works: Encourages interaction and shares.

 

5. Myth Busting / Martial Arts Facts

  • Example: “Does black belt mean you’re a master? (Spoiler: Nope!)”
  • Why it works: Debunking common misconceptions keeps viewers hooked.

The 3-Step Posting Strategy for Busy Martial Arts School Owners

 

You don’t need to post every day—consistency beats quantity. Follow this simple system:

 

Step 1: Batch Record 5-10 Videos at Once

  • Set aside one hour per week to film multiple short videos.
  • Change outfits or angles for variety.

 

Step 2: Post 3x Per Week

  • Best posting times: 12 PM – 3 PM or 6 PM – 9 PM (your local time).
  • Stick to a Monday/Wednesday/Friday schedule for consistency.


Step 3: Engage With Viewers

  • Reply to every comment, like, and DM to build relationships.
  • Ask questions to encourage discussion.


Ninja Hack:
Use the first 3 seconds of your video to hook the viewer with a strong opening line like:

  • “Here’s why most people FAIL their first martial arts test…”
  • “If you’re struggling with [common problem], try this…”

How to Turn Views Into New Students (The Conversion Strategy)

 

Getting views is great, but we want real student sign-ups. Here’s how:

 

1. Add a Call-to-Action (CTA) in Every Video

  • Example: “Want to train with us? DM ‘TRY’ for a free class!”
  • Keep it simple and direct—people need a clear next step.

 

2. Optimize Your Bio & Links

  • Use a link-in-bio tool (like Linktree) to direct viewers to:
    • Your free trial sign-up page
    • Your class schedule
    • Your website
